EMPIRE AIR MAILS

ENGLAND TO AUSTRALIA

LETTERS FOR NEW ZEALAND POSSIBLE SPECIAL FLIGHT The first trip in the England-Aus-tralia air-mail service will he made in December. No arrangements have been Announced to enable letters for NewZealand to reach the Dominion before Christmas, but it is understood there is a possibility of this being done. It is hoped that in the next fewweeks plans will be made by which the Dominion section of the mail will be brought from Australia by air and distributed to the main centres by similar means, resulting in letters which leave London on December 8 being delivered in New Zealand a day or two before Christmas. There are similar expectations concerning mail from New Zealand to' connect with the air-liner scheduled to leave Brisbane for England on December 10. This mail is due in London 14 days later. It is understood that two concerns intend approaching the department in New Zealand with schemes for transtasmaa (lights. The trips would probably be made on a similar basis to the air-mail flights of Sir Charles Kingsford Smith and Mr. C. T. 1\ Ulm. The possibility of a special New Zealand stamp being issued to mark the occasion has also been mentioned. The issue of a new Is 6d stamp for use on the Australia-England service has been arranged in the Commonwealth. The England-Australia air-mail service will be the longest in the world. It will be weekly, and provides for a 12 days' journey from Brisbane to London, but in order that the Duke of Gloucester may be able to despatch the first machine from Brisbane on December 10, the first outward trip has been extended to 14 days.
